Dakota Alert MURS Alert MAPS Specifications

General IconGeneral
Frequency151.820 MHz, 151.880 MHz, 151.940 MHz, 154.570 MHz, 154.600 MHz
Channels5
Power Output2 Watts
Power SourceBattery
TypeMURS Transmitter
Water ResistanceWeatherproof
Operating Temperature-20°F to 120 degrees Fahrenheit

Warnings and Power Supply

RF Exposure and Antenna Guidelines

Maintain 2-inch separation from body during transmission for compliance with FCC guidelines.

Power Supply and Battery Recommendations

Use quality CR123 batteries, replace all at once, and expect approximately 6 months of life.

Functionality

Detection and Installation

Probe detects vehicles within 14 ft; bury probe/wire in pipe for protection against damage.

Alert Signal Types

The device transmits one of four distinct alert signals for detected targets: Zone One to Four.

Operation and Configuration

Transmitter Access and Sensitivity Control

Open the case to access the transmitter; adjust sensitivity using the black knob.

Channel and CTCSS Selection

Select MURS channels using SW1 and CTCSS codes (01-38) using SW2 and SW3.

Alert Signal Zone Selection

Use the four-position slide switch SW4 to select one of four alert zones.
